Virgil IoT KIT
Data Fields
vs_firmware_header_t Struct Reference

Firmware header. More...

#include <firmware.h>

Collaboration diagram for vs_firmware_header_t:
Collaboration graph
[legend]

Data Fields

uint32_t code_offset
 Code offset = sizeof(vs_firmware_header_t) More...
 
uint32_t code_length
 Code length = vs_firmware_descriptor_t . More...
 
uint32_t footer_offset
 Footer offset = code_offset + code_length. More...
 
uint32_t footer_length
 Footer length. More...
 
uint8_t signatures_count
 Signatures amount. More...
 
vs_firmware_descriptor_t descriptor
 Firnware descriptor. More...
 

Detailed Description

Firmware header.

Field Documentation

◆ code_length

uint32_t vs_firmware_header_t::code_length

Code length = vs_firmware_descriptor_t .

firmware_length

◆ code_offset

uint32_t vs_firmware_header_t::code_offset

Code offset = sizeof(vs_firmware_header_t)

◆ descriptor

vs_firmware_descriptor_t vs_firmware_header_t::descriptor

Firnware descriptor.

◆ footer_length

uint32_t vs_firmware_header_t::footer_length

Footer length.

◆ footer_offset

uint32_t vs_firmware_header_t::footer_offset

Footer offset = code_offset + code_length.

◆ signatures_count

uint8_t vs_firmware_header_t::signatures_count

Signatures amount.


The documentation for this struct was generated from the following file: